Great
Cruz Bay was originally a relatively shallow bay surrounded by
mangrove wet lands with a mud bottom. The bay was dredged and
sand was brought in to create the sandy beach that is now there.
The depth increases gradually, and there are no sea urchins or
reef to worry about. The water is not as clear as in some of
the other bays. The bay is generally calm and free from the ground
sea or breaking surf that is common on north shore beaches in
the winter. The hotel has done an excellent job of landscaping,
and the beach and grounds of the hotel are beautiful.
Getting
There
Starting at the Texaco Station in Cruz Bay go east 0.9 miles
on Route 104. Turn right at the entrance to the Westin Resort.
Park in the hotel parking lot and walk to the beach.

Facilities
Day visitors can use the beach, but the facilities such as lounge
chairs and beach equipment are for use by Westin guests only.
Facilities available to day visitors include water sports rentals,
shops, the restaurants and the bar by the pool.
